Using above laws, following scientific principle has been devised and
disclosed.

When in two or more systems points, from which the opposite reaction
in said systems is supposed to start, are connected to each other in
such a way that these points are forced to travel in different
directions, then due to connectivity, the opposite reaction in said
systems is halted and only action takes place in these systems.

[...]

When they "are connected to each other in such a way that [they] are
*forced* to travel in different directions" (emphasis mine), you're
introducing additional forces. It sounds like you're not taking these
extra forces into account. So, your claim that "due to connectivity,
the opposite reaction in said systems is halted" is incorrect (taking
your use of the word "halted" in a way that seems consistent with what
you're claiming).

Anyway, Newton's laws of motion (which you seem to be accepting as true)
mean that your invention could never work the way you claim.
